Customer Service Rep(01775) - 208 A Ave W

Iowa, Oskaloosa

flag as prohibited / miscategorized / spam / false



Job Details

ID #54706267
State Iowa
City Oskaloosa
Showed 2025-10-23
Date 2025-10-23
Deadline 2025-12-22
Category Et cetera